Viewport Print Problem

When I print a drawing from model space, my linetypes thicknesses and shade come our correct.

If I move the object from model space to paper space and print my drawing, my linetypes thicknesses and shade come our correct.

But if I attempt to plot in paper space a viewport, my linetypes and thicknesses within that viewport simply come out solid black....not shaded.

any ideas?

Hey CC;

Is your laser capable of screening? Some are, and some aren't.

When I've had the pleasure (?) of using those that aren't I usually am
forced into making an special CTB (I know you said STB) that will take all
the Screened colors and instead use very thin lineweights.

Would your STB (or a new one named for this laser) have the same options?
